The Passionate Programmer: Igniting the Flames of Purpose in Your Code

Photo by RetroSupply on Unsplash

The Passionate Programmer: Igniting the Flames of Purpose in Your Code

Table of contents

No heading

No headings in the article.

Introduction:

Passion is the driving force that propels individuals to achieve greatness in any endeavor. For programmers, the act of coding goes beyond a mere job; it becomes an art, a craft, and a journey of self-discovery. In this article, we explore the mindset of the passionate programmer—the one who finds purpose in their code, seeks continuous growth, and leaves an indelible mark on the world through their creations.

  1. The Call of the Code: Finding Purpose in Programming

Passion begins with purpose. We delve into how passionate programmers discover their purpose, whether it's through solving real-world problems, creating innovative applications, or making a positive impact on the lives of others. Understanding the "why" behind coding ignites the flames of purpose that fuel their journey.

  1. Embracing the Art of Creativity: Coding as an Expression of Self

Programming is more than just writing lines of code; it's an art form. Passionate programmers view their code as an expression of their creativity and craftsmanship. We explore how they infuse their unique perspectives and insights into their code, turning functional solutions into elegant masterpieces.

  1. Pursuing Mastery: The Never-Ending Quest for Knowledge

Passionate programmers are perpetual learners. We discuss how they thrive on learning new languages, frameworks, and technologies, constantly seeking to expand their skillset and deepen their understanding. The pursuit of mastery becomes an intrinsic part of their identity.

  1. Navigating Challenges: Turning Obstacles into Opportunities

Every programmer faces challenges, but passionate programmers embrace them as opportunities for growth. We explore how they approach obstacles with a positive mindset, using failures as stepping stones to success and learning valuable lessons along the way.

  1. Building a Supportive Community: Fostering Collaboration and Growth

Passion is contagious, and passionate programmers know the value of a supportive community. We showcase how they actively engage with like-minded individuals, contribute to open-source projects, and mentor aspiring developers, creating a thriving ecosystem of collaboration and growth.

  1. Balancing Passion and Burnout: Taking Care of the Programmer Within

While passion drives programmers forward, burnout can be a real threat. We discuss the importance of self-care and maintaining a healthy work-life balance. Passionate programmers recognize the need to recharge and rejuvenate to sustain their enthusiasm for the long run.

  1. Leaving a Legacy: Impacting the Future of Programming

A passionate programmer's journey doesn't end with their code; it extends to the impact they leave behind. We explore how they mentor and inspire the next generation of programmers, leaving a lasting legacy that shapes the future of the industry.

Conclusion:

Passion is the heartbeat of a programmer's journey—a force that propels them beyond mere technical expertise. The passionate programmer finds purpose, creativity, and continuous growth in their craft. They embrace challenges, cultivate supportive communities, and leave a lasting legacy that ignites the passion of others. By understanding the power of passion in programming, we can unlock our true potential, making a profound impact on the world through the lines of code we write. So, let us embrace the mantle of the passionate programmer and embark on a journey filled with purpose, creativity, and boundless opportunities for growth.